Ordinals
beta
Sat 844465271494230
decimal
168893.271494230
degree
0°168893′1565″271494230‴
percentile
40.21263202014963%
name
hwfhfysolct
cycle
0
epoch
0
period
83
block
168893
offset
271494230
timestamp
2012-02-28 14:36:34 UTC
rarity
common
prev
next